Annual VANGUARD meeting held in Igls, Austria

Team members of the VANGUARD project travelled to Igls in Austria for the annual consortium meeting which was held on 22 January 2023. The full day meeting covered the research progress of all work packages in the first three years of the project, the next steps planned and enough time for lively discussions between representatives […]

Watch the VANGUARD project video online

During the annual VANGUARD project meeting 2022 held in Geneva, Switzerland we spoke to all project partners involved about the objectives of VANGUARD, their role within the project and the possible impact generating a vascularized and immune-protected bioartificial pancreas that can be transplanted into non-immuno-suppressed patients can have. Presentation at 29th International Congress of The Transplantation Society

VANGUARD was presented at the 29th International Congress of The Transplantation Society (TTS 2022) which was held in Buenos Aires from 10-14 September 2022. The abstract for the VANGUARD presentation titled Generation of Prevascularized Endocrine Constructs to Treat Type 1 Diabetes is available online and was published in Transplantation as part of the conference proceedings.
